Monochrome Rainbow

What do you know about rainbow?


A rainbow is a meteorological phenomenon that is caused by reflection, refraction, and dispersion of light in water droplets resulting in a spectrum of light appearing in the sky. It takes the form of a multicolored circular are. Rainbows caused by sunlight always appear in the section of sky directly opposite the sun.
We can see it in many colors combination such as red, orange, yellow, green, blue, indigo, and violet.

So I will tell you about monochrome rainbow.



  • Monochrome or red rainbow is an optical and meteorological phenomenon and a rare variation of the more commonly multicolored rainbow.


Its formation process is identical to that of a normal rainbow (namely the reflection/refraction of light in water droplets), the difference being that a monochrome rainbow requires the sun to be close to the horizon; i.e., near sunrise or sunset.


  • Then why the color is red?

Red Rainbow happen when the sun is on the horizon. They're created for much the same reason that a sunset or sunrise looks red. Because, when the sun is low, the blue and green of its rays are weakened by scattering during the long journey to your eyes through Earth's atmosphere. The red light travels through more directly. And that's it you see a red rainbow.

It happens when you're watching a sunset, and there's rain in the air, turn in the direction opposite the sun and watch for the elusive red rainbow. But it is not certain because red rainbow is a rare.
